Subject: Load test access — Cartwheel checkout

Team,

Load tests for the Cartwheel checkout flow run nightly at 02:00. Target the staging gateway only. Ramp: 50 to 800 VUs over 10 minutes, hold 20. Abort if p99 exceeds 4s. Results land in the shared dashboard. For the load harness to reach staging, use the bearer token below.

session JWT of yahif-bawig = eyJhbGciOiJIUzI1NiIsInR5cCI6IkpXVCJ9.eyJzdWIiOiIaWAxmMIn0.GYffpIaj

Meeting notes — Trailmark offline mode (security review prep). We walked through how survey data gets cached on-device when field teams lose signal: local store is encrypted, sync retries on reconnect, and nothing sensitive sits in plaintext logs (we think — please verify). Conflict resolution still feels hand-wavy, flagged for follow-up. For any questions during the review, the person responsible for the offline mode is named below.

approver of hahig-kahap = Fraeth Nordor Normir

☐ Pool config attestation — welcome aboard! During the Larkspur key ceremony we also snapshot the database connection-pool settings for the Ottervale cluster, since the new keys get baked into the pooler's auth layer. Double-check max connections, idle timeout, and that the failover replica points at the right pooler before anyone signs off. Sounds boring, but a bad pool config once took us down for hours. When the auditor nods, read out the recovery passphrase shown below.

unlock words, fafop-hawep: briwyn-oliix-sorox

### Capacity note: soft deletes in `orders`

Soft-deleted rows on the Marrowgate orders table now exceed live rows, inflating index bloat and vacuum times. The reaper job purges in batches during the low-traffic window; pausing it for more than two days risks disk pressure on the primary. The reaper's current batch and pacing constants are shown below.

tuning table, kahop-fafog:
CAPS = {
    "gilael": 682,
    "ralael": 264,
}